Hugo Reihl has been competing for 4 years. His best event is the 3×3: a personal-best single of 13.70, set at Warm Up Seattle 2025, puts him in the top 19.9% of the 284,439 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 10,718th in the United States. Across 12 competitions since September 2022, he has put 247 official solves on the record across seven events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 13% around a typical one; 57% of the 35,811 competitors with ten or more counted rounds hold a tighter spread. His 3×3 best has come down from 47.51 in September 2022 to 13.70, a 71% improvement. Hugo has entered twelve competitions, more competitions than 94%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
